Mongolian Beef Noodles

Mongolian Beef Noodles: 7 Reasons You’ll Adore This Dish


  • Author: Louna
  • Total Time: 30 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ings 1x
  • Diet: Gluten Free

Description

A savory dish featuring beef and noodles in a rich sauce.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 8 oz. noodles
  • 1 lb. beef, sliced
  • 2 tbsp. soy sauce
  • 1 tbsp. oyster sauce
  • 1 tbsp. cornstarch
  • 2 tbsp. vegetable oil
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 cup bell peppers, sliced
  • 1 cup green onions, chopped
  • 1 tsp. ginger, minced

Instructions

  1. Cook noodles according to package instructions.
  2. Mix beef with soy sauce and cornstarch.
  3. Heat oil in a pan over medium heat.
  4. Add beef and cook until browned.
  5. Add garlic, ginger, and bell peppers.
  6. Stir-fry for 3-4 minutes.
  7. Add cooked noodles and oyster sauce.
  8. Mix well and cook for another 2 minutes.
  9. Garnish with green onions.

Notes

  • Adjust sauce to taste.
  • Use any vegetables you prefer.
  • Can substitute beef with chicken or tofu.
